Billy Napier addressed the status of quarterback Jack Miller and offensive lineman O’Cyrus Torrence during his Wednesday press conference previewing Florida’s game vs. LSU on Saturday.

Miller had undergone surgery before the season to repair an injured right thumb. While the Ohio State transfer has had yet to practice in 2022, he is back on the depth chart, according to OnlyGators.com. However, Napier noted that he hadn’t decided if Miller would back Anthony Richardson up against the Tigers.

As for Torrence, he has been deemed questionable according to the team’s injury report. Napier didn’t disclose the nature of the injury, only stating that Torrence had been held out of practice. Richie Leonard is being listed as the starter at right guard if Torrence can’t go, with Jalen Farmer behind Leonard.

“[Torrence is] a guy who hasn’t participated in practice, and we’ll make some decisions over the next couple days,” Napier said.

Kickoff between the Gators and Tigers on Saturday from Gainesville is set for 7 p.m. ET on ESPN.
